The Microbial Defense: How Food Microbiology Testing is Safeguarding the Dairy Supply Chain

Microbiological contamination poses one of the greatest risks to the safety and shelf-life of dairy products. Food microbiology testing is the frontline defense against these invisible threats. This market is not just about a single test; it is about a comprehensive strategy to identify and control pathogenic and spoilage microorganisms throughout the dairy production process.

The most critical application of food microbiology testing is the detection of pathogens such as Salmonella, Listeria monocytogenes, and E. coli, which can cause severe foodborne illness. The high incidence of foodborne outbreaks linked to dairy products is a primary driver for this market. The emergence of rapid and accurate molecular testing methods, such as PCR and whole-genome sequencing, is significantly impacting the market, enabling faster identification of pathogens and improved outbreak response. The increased focus on preventive controls is driving the demand for environmental monitoring and hygiene testing.

The evolution of food microbiology testing is marked by a continuous drive towards greater speed, accuracy, and ease of use. The development of automated testing systems is a key trend, improving laboratory efficiency and throughput. The focus on developing rapid and portable testing devices is a significant opportunity to enable on-site testing. The development of biosensors and other innovative detection technologies is a key area of research. The focus on developing methods that can distinguish between live and dead cells is improving the accuracy of testing. The focus on developing comprehensive testing programs that integrate pathogen detection with spoilage organism monitoring is improving overall product quality.
